I have a basic question about BI 7.3 installation; In our organization we are planning to install BI 7.3 system as ABAP+JAVA stack installation, but what I understand from SAP documents that SAP strongly recommend to install both the systems as separate stacks.
Now issue is we cannot afford one extra system for BI implementations as BI system will be used by small number of users.
So question is
Can I install ABAP+JAVA dual stack (With Same SID) for BW 7.3
If yes then Will NW 7.3 installation master gives this option?
If not then what would be the best possible way to achieve the separate stack installation on single server (NO MCOD please)

I had a similar case where I had to install a java stack for an already existing CRM system running on Windows/SQL Server.
I installed a different SID for Java on the same host and I installed the Java database as a second database in the same SQL server engine.
Therefore I shared the hardware resources but still had 2 separate stacks as best practice.
